What is 'foreign exchange' in the tourism context?
Trading goods between countries
Converting one country's currency into another for travel
Exchanging travel vouchers between companies
Selling souvenirs to foreign tourists
Answer explanation
Foreign exchange means converting one country's currency into another, essential for international travel.

Explain ONE way that money spent by inbound international tourists benefits local people DIRECTLY.
Evaluate responses using AI:
OFF
Answer explanation
Sample Answer:
Direct benefits include job creation in tourism businesses (hotels, restaurants, tour guides), wages paid to local employees, and income for local craft sellers and service providers.

If the exchange rate for US Dollars is R18.50, calculate how many dollars a tourist will receive when exchanging R3,700.
Evaluate responses using AI:
OFF
Answer explanation
Calculation: R3,700 ÷ 18.50 = $200.00. Always divide rands by the exchange rate to get foreign currency.

Which is Namibia's most popular wildlife park known for its large salt pan?
Okavango Delta
Etosha National Park
Kruger National Park
Serengeti
Answer explanation
Etosha National Park in Namibia is famous for wildlife viewing and its characteristic large salt pan (Etosha Pan).

Name TWO South African World Heritage Sites.
Evaluate responses using AI:
OFF
Answer explanation
Examples include: Robben Island, iSimangaliso Wetland Park, Cradle of Humankind, uKhahlamba-Drakensberg Park, Mapungubwe Cultural Landscape, Cape Floral Region, Richtersveld Cultural Landscape, Vredefort Dome.
